    Dunno, those new games (rift/aion) most of the time don't have the comfortable feeling wow has, somehow. Wow also has a particular art style which I would choose anytime over ''high end graphics''.

    Action MMOs are fun, but they must have the content necessary to keep things interesting without it getting too repetitive and making content for an action game is a bit more difficult to do than for a normal mmo.

    Some rift players are already coming back to wow, getting tired of farming rifts, from what I've heard, this 'new dynamic world events' gets old kinda fast. They are kind of like a random boss spawn, fun to see in a game, but it ain't that insane either. I didn't play the game long enough to input my own opinion on this subject though. I don't know much about the rest of the game, the only reason I can't leave wow/ragnarok for it is the art style and the comfy-ness of those 2 games.

    Keep in mind though that you're only talking about graphics, gameplay, innovation, but it will require more than that to kill wow, it will take time. People often forget about the social aspect of the game, players that've been playing it for 2 years are not likely to abandon their char, all their ingame friends, their guild and the world of warcraft itself just cause a new game has eye candies and some gameplay.

    I still say, only time will kill it.
